Queerlandia is back for it’s third year, conjuring new pleasures with an extravagant hybrid of Portland’s queer magic!
We’re mixing and mashing beauty and awe into a new creature of pleasure and ecstasy.
Six DJs, Carla Rossi’s Carnival Grotesque, a marketplace of local queer crafts and art, caricature artist Tuna Doodle, go-go dancers and hosted by Serendipity Jones! Madness!
Thursday June 13 9pm-2am
Embers 110 NW Broadway
$5 ($1 from each admission donated to Bradley Angle’s LGBT Domestic Violence Services)

“I have been afraid to reveal this aspect of myself because people don’t like you to wear too many hats – they criticise you for it. I didn’t want it to be seen as disposable, because art is not disposable to me. When you do a movie or you are working in television, the people that you work with become your life; it is a very intimate experience that takes you somewhere emotionally. The experience of painting something has the same effect. Whether the painting is a success or a failure, the time that I was involved in it remains the same.” — Lucy Liu
